State troopers, with the help of a few good Samaritans, stopped traffic and picked up the escapee: Stitch, a giant sulcata tortoise with a sand-colored shell.
Stitch broke out of his enclosure and a few layers of fences at the Rooster Cogburn Ostrich Ranch before being found on the four-lane highway.
The night before escaping, storms damaged ranch gates and enclosures, helping Stitch make his getaway despite being one of the only two tortoises small enough to fit through the fence.
"How in the world or where he got out? Ms. Cogburn said. I'm not really sure." - Danna Cogburn, owner of the ranch, expressing surprise at Stitch's escape route.
